do you think she will forgive and forget?!
I think there's a difference between forgiving and forgetting.
One of my (long departed) cats was once stood under the door keys in the lock of the back door, waiting to go out and when I touched they keys, the key ring broke and the keys (probably about 3 of them) fell on his head.
He shot off up the garden when I finally got the door open and for ever afterwards, he wouldn't stand under the door keys, both back door and front door. In fact, he hated door keys even in my hand.
He was fine with me though as soon as he came back in.
So, he didn't forget but he did forgive.
